Summary

Yann LeCun, a famous expert in artificial intelligence, has started a new company called AMI Labs with $1 billion in funding. Even though the company only has 12 employees, investors are putting huge amounts of money into its unique vision. Unlike most AI companies today, AMI Labs is not building large language models like the ones used for chatbots. Instead, they are working on a new type of AI that uses smaller, specialized parts to solve specific problems more efficiently.

Key Details

What Happened

Yann LeCun recently left his role as the top AI scientist at Meta to launch Advanced Machine Intelligence Labs, or AMI Labs. He believes that the current way of building AI, which relies on reading massive amounts of internet text, has reached its limit. His new company is a research-focused group that does not plan to sell a product for at least five years. They are taking their time to rethink the basic building blocks of machine intelligence.

Important Numbers and Facts

  • Funding: The startup has raised $1 billion from investors.
  • Team Size: The company currently operates with a small team of only 12 people.
  • Timeline: AMI Labs expects to spend about five years on research before releasing a commercial product.
  • Model Size: While current AI models use hundreds of billions of data points, AMI Labs aims to use models with only a few hundred million points, making them much smaller and faster.

Background and Context

Most AI we use today, such as ChatGPT or Claude, are called Large Language Models (LLMs). These systems learn by looking at almost everything written on the internet. While they are good at writing and talking, they often struggle with logic or understanding how the physical world works. They also cost a lot of money to maintain. Yann LeCun argues that these systems are "generalists" that know a little bit about everything but aren't truly smart in the way humans are. AMI Labs wants to build AI that understands specific rules and environments, similar to how a person learns a specific job.

The Modular Approach

Instead of one giant brain, the AMI Labs system uses several specialized parts working together. These include:

  • A World Model: A part that understands the specific area the AI is working in, such as a specific factory or a type of law.
  • An Actor: The part that suggests what the AI should do next.
  • A Critic: A safety part that checks the suggestions against a set of hard rules to make sure they are correct.
  • Perception: Tools that allow the AI to "see" or "hear" using video, audio, or images.
  • Short-term Memory: A way for the AI to remember what just happened so it can make better decisions.

What This Means Going Forward

If this new approach works, it could change the entire AI industry. Currently, only the biggest tech companies can afford to build AI because it is so expensive. If AMI Labs proves that smaller, specialized models are better, it could open the door for smaller companies to build their own AI tools. It also means AI could become more reliable. Because these models use a "critic" to check their work against real-world rules, they might stop making the common mistakes and "hallucinations" that current chatbots often make.
